Leukemia, a type of … WebDec 15, 2024 · In adults, their presence in the blood indicates a problem with bone marrow integrity or red blood cell production. Your doctor may order an NRBC test if other blood test results (such as CBC) indicate blood cell issues. A normal result is 0 NRBCs/100 WBCs or a complete absence of NRBCs in the blood.

WebApr 13, 2024 · RBCs or Red Blood Cells contain haemoglobin and get made in the bone marrow. These cells are also known as erythrocytes. The erythrocyte test is a blood test that measures the levels of erythrocytes in the blood and is usually done as part of the CBC test. RBC count in this test can help diagnose anaemia and other conditions that affect RBCs.

WebThe laboratory studies listed below are helpful in the diagnosis and management of iron deficiency. ... In iron deficiency anemia, the RBC decreases in proportion to the decrease in hemoglobin concentration while in thalassemia the RBC may be normal or increased relative to the degree of anemia as indicated by the hemoglobin concentration.

WebDec 22, 2016 · A. Hemolysis is defined as the release of hemoglobin and other intracellular components as a result of red blood cell (RBC) destruction. Specifically, hemolysis is present if the free hemoglobin is greater than 0.3 g/L.1 The effect on the complete blood count (CBC) results due to red cell destruction inaccurately decreases the red blood cell ...

WebOct 7, 2024 · Mean cell volume (MCV) is a calculated average red blood cell (RBC) volume. An MCV greater than 100 fL is macrocytosis by definition. Because evaluation of RBC size is key to the diagnosis of an anemia, the MCV is considered to be the most important of the RBC indices. ...
